Come and learn the true nature of clouds and atmospheric effects and paint them with confidence. In this class you will learn to understand the types of clouds, the nuances of shading, coloring, and painting them for effect, and how to avoid painting the dreaded “cotton balls.”
This class is open to all mediums. Students will be required to provide their own materials for this program. You will need a substrate to paint on (watercolor paper or canvas), paints in a variety of colors (primaries, white, black, and browns), brushes including rounds and filberts, water, and mister for watercolor and acrylic, for oil they will need Gamsol, and linseed oil or liquin impasto.
